What is an AMR file?#
An AMR file holds speech compressed with Adaptive Multi-Rate, the narrowband codec 3GPP standardized in 1999 for GSM phone calls, which is why voice memos and MMS voice messages recorded on older phones end up in this format.
There is rarely a reason to keep audio as AMR once it is off the phone that made it, since the format exists for the transmission link, not for storage.
Convert AMR to MP3 or WAV so an old voice memo or MMS recording opens in ordinary media players and editing software, keeping in mind the recording will still sound like a phone call because that ceiling was set at capture, not by the format.
What is an OGG file?#
An OGG file is an Ogg-container file that, under the Xiph.Org Foundation's own naming convention, holds audio encoded with the Vorbis codec, an open, royalty-free lossy compressor comparable to MP3 or AAC.
Use OGG for Vorbis-encoded audio on Linux, in games, or anywhere royalty-free lossy compression matters more than universal playback.
Convert OGG to MP3 or AAC when the destination device or software has no Vorbis decoder, which is still common on Windows and iOS without a third-party player.

Why are my voice memos and MMS recordings AMR files?
AMR is the speech codec GSM and 3G phones use for voice calls, so many phones' voice recorder apps and MMS voice messages reused the same codec rather than encoding a separate format. That link to phone-call audio is also why AMR recordings sound like a phone call, thin and narrowband, rather than like a full-range voice recording.
What plays AMR files?
VLC plays AMR files on every major platform, and Android's own voice recorder and messaging apps read them natively since AMR originated on that ecosystem. Standard desktop media players such as Windows Media Player or QuickTime generally do not.
What should I convert AMR to?
Convert AMR to MP3 or WAV so the recording opens in any media player or editor. Converting will not improve the sound, since AMR only ever captured the narrow speech frequency range a phone call uses, and no conversion can add back detail the codec discarded at recording time.
What's the difference between OGG and OGA?
OGG and OGA are the same Ogg container format with different extensions marking what's inside. Since 2007, Xiph.Org's convention reserves .ogg for audio specifically encoded with Vorbis, while .oga is the codec-agnostic extension for Ogg audio that might hold Vorbis, FLAC, Speex or another codec. In practice many tools ignore the distinction and use .ogg for any Ogg audio.
